JQuery cxSelect是一款開源、免費的插件,用于快速、簡單地生成多級聯動下拉選擇框。該插件支持自定義數據源,且支持對選擇框的外觀進行自定義。JQuery cxSelect提供了簡單易用的API,可以幫助開發者輕松地實現多級聯動下拉選擇框的交互效果。
// 初始化cxSelect $('#selector1').cxSelect({ // 數據源 url: 'data.json', // 配置項 selects: ['province', 'city', 'area'], emptyStyle: 'none' });
在上述代碼中,我們調用cxSelect函數,通過傳遞一個配置對象作為參數,初始化了cxSelect插件。其中,我們傳遞了一個數據源的URL,表示該下拉選擇框所需的數據從指定的URL處獲取。我們還傳遞了一個selects數組,表示該下拉選擇框需要生成的幾個級別的下拉選擇框的ID。最后,我們還指定了emptyStyle為none,表示當一個下拉選擇框沒有選項時,該下拉選擇框應該如何顯示。
JQuery cxSelect在實現多級聯動下拉選擇框時,會根據選擇框的value值和數據源中的數據,去查詢下一級別的選項。例如,當我們選擇了一個省份,該插件會根據該省份的value值,去獲取下一級別城市的選項。因此,我們可以利用該特性,實現多級聯動下拉選擇框的交互效果。